About House By The Dyke
At the top of Offa’s Dyke this 1930s villa is in a great spot for exploring nearby Chirk Castle.The holiday home boasts a large rear terrace with a seating area and lawned gardens, perfect for relaxing and admiring this spectacular countryside.
Enjoy a long, lazy alfresco lunch with all the family before exploring the nearby Chirk Castle and its grounds. Take a tour with one of our rangers and see how the support from your stay helps us to care for these special places. You can also pick up information on the many walking trails available, including the famous Offa’s Dyke.
Further afield, experience the slower paced life of the beautiful canals of Llangollen. Snowdonia, with its spectacular mountains and towering waterfalls, is also just a short drive away

Layout
-
Ground floor
Entrance porch, three bedrooms (1 double with 5’ sleigh bed, one single and there is a twin bedroom which can be made as a 6' double on request), bathroom with electric shower over bath, lounge with patio doors open out onto the terrace, kitchen, lavatory, utility room, dining room with double doors leading into conservatory.
Notes for guests
Access: The accessibility guide is for guidance only. For up to date photos, please see the images on the webpage.
Heating: The cottage is heated by an air source heat pump.
Parking: Parking for 3 cars on a graveled area at the front of the cottage.
Garden: Main Garden at rear of property with decking area. Garden furniture on terrace.
